JsonPropertyInfo.AttributeProvider Propriété
Définition
Important
Certaines informations portent sur la préversion du produit qui est susceptible d’être en grande partie modifiée avant sa publication. Microsoft exclut toute garantie, expresse ou implicite, concernant les informations fournies ici.
Obtient ou définit le fournisseur d’attributs personnalisé pour la propriété actuelle.
public:
property System::Reflection::ICustomAttributeProvider ^ AttributeProvider { System::Reflection::ICustomAttributeProvider ^ get(); void set(System::Reflection::ICustomAttributeProvider ^ value); };
public System.Reflection.ICustomAttributeProvider? AttributeProvider { get; set; }
member this.AttributeProvider : System.Reflection.ICustomAttributeProvider with get, set
Public Property AttributeProvider As ICustomAttributeProvider
Valeur de propriété
Exceptions
L’instance JsonPropertyInfo a été verrouillée pour une modification ultérieure.
Remarques
Lors de la résolution des métadonnées via DefaultJsonTypeInfoResolver, cette propriété est remplie avec le sous-jacent MemberInfo de la propriété ou du champ sérialisé.
La définition d’un fournisseur d’attributs personnalisés n’a aucun impact sur le modèle de contrat, mais sert de métadonnées pour les modificateurs de contrat en aval.